Parts:
- PP1014 - IPX6 Surface Mount XLR Male Connector
- LM2596 based Arduino Compatible DC Voltage Regulator
- Terminal block - 2 terminals
- Connect positive wire between Pin 1 of XLR Male Connector and terminal 1 of terminal block.
- Connect negative wire between Pin <check - 2 or 3> and terminal 2 of terminal block.
- Connect another positive wire between terminal 1 of terminal block and Positive IN of LM2596.
- Connect another negative wire between terminal 2 of terminal block and Negative IN of LM2596.
- Connect positive wire terminated in Jumper socket to Positive OUT of LM2596. This goes to Positive Pin of J4 on PiJuice Zero.
- Connect negative wire terminated in Jumper socket to Negative OUT of LM2596. This goes to Negative Pin of J4 on PiJuice Zero.
